     Nexus is not a single setting but a bunch of different settings all tied together by a dimension called the Nexus. Through the Nexus you can reach many Earths. The major limitation however is that only Earths fairly rich in magical energies can be reached through the Nexus because it is a realm of magic. Some settings are of a low mana level, just enough to bridge to from the Nexus. They may know of magic but see it as dangerous and mysterious. Others are high in mana and magic is a part of their everyday lives.

     Nexus is a system and a universal setting. Through it you can run any world or genre you want. Several different genre settings are laid out. You can have characters cross over from any genre that your GM wants to allow. This system can be used for a single game or a multiverse game. You can use it to play this setting, your own setting, or even published settings that you like but don't like their system. It is all up to the GM and the players. Have fun with it.

The Nexus

     The Nexus is a realm that connects to many different other realms. It also contains objects of it's own, islands floating in a vast astral sea. Some of these are the homes of Sorcerers and their Towers. Some are fragments of other realms, ways of getting to them. Some are alive and have their own agenda. You can travel through the nebula from one Earth to another all floating in the same orbit but each one different. These are the shadows of each Earth in the Nexus. From there you can go into the physical realm.

     The Nexus can be traveled by any space going vessel that finds a way to get there. There is no normal air in the Nexus except around the islands. There are blue clouds almost like a nebula that fills the void between the islands. There are also spirits and ghosts in the clouds, as well as large auqatic creatures that move through the Nexus clouds like whale or dragons. They will go around an island but ships can be struck by an uncaring shoulder, tail, or fin. Some spirits can find their way on to ships and cause problems as well.

     Despite all these dangers there are people from many realms that risk the Nexus to travel and trade. They trade goods from high tech worlds to low tech worlds or healthy worlds to post apocalyptic ones. Anything to help a world they care for or make a profit if they don't care at all. Anything is possible there. It is a multiversal cross roads.

The Spirit World

     Many of these islands and most of the planets have their own realm of nature that reflects the magical nature of their world. This means that there are many realms of the Fey and various Nature Spirits on each Earth and on many of the islands of the Nexus. Some can travel from planet to island to island to planet as if they were riding horses in a vast mist. Others create powerful gate as human mages do allowing them to walk from one gate to another. It is these spirits of Nature that first taught men these magics.

     There are also cities in what many people call the Middle World. These spirit cities are echoes of the history of the cities that have been there before. The paths through these cities do not conform to the real world but they often have connections. It is possible to go from the city into the wilderness of the spirit and back but travel is more by intent then navigation. You can also connect with the Astral realms through traveling up into the Upper World. This is the land of thought and the best way to get to the Nexus without a gate. The spirit body that can travel in these worlds is usually called an Astral body but that does not mean that it is restricted to or even starts out every time in the Astral. Most of the time it appears in the Middle World echo of their room.

     Each planet and large island can have it's own land of the dead. They are places of darkness and rest that Necromancers reach into to force spirits of the dead to do their bidding. Sometimes the realms of the dead reach into places in the Middle World from this Lower World. This is the source of Haunted Houses.

     There are many races that exist on all the many Earths. Some Earths have many intelligent races and others only humanity. Many races have traveled from one Earth to another and are found on several worlds. Others may be examples of parallel growth. Much of this is lost to history or considered a secret.
